Steps to Create and Sell Art at Home
Creating and selling art at home requires a combination of creativity, skill, and strategic marketing. Here are the key steps to follow:
1. Identify Your Skill Set
Start by identifying the skills you are passionate about and have a natural talent for. This could be painting, sculpture, photography, or anything that you can express through your art.
2. Develop a Unique Style
Create a unique style that sets your art apart from others. Consistency in your style will help you build a loyal fan base.
3. Utilize Online Platforms
There are numerous online platforms where you can showcase your artwork, such as Etsy, Society6, or your own website. These platforms offer a wide audience and can help you reach potential buyers.
4. Promote Your Art
Use social media platforms like Instagram, Twitter, and Facebook to promote your art. Engage with your audience, and share your creative process to build a community of supporters.
5. Set Competitive Prices
Research the market to determine the value of your art. Setting competitive prices that reflect the quality and uniqueness of your work can help you attract buyers.
